Dr Suzanne Lampert

Assistant Professor

I am an Assistant Professor in Economics. I am on a Teaching and Scholarship pathway; and my research is centred on pedagogy.  

My teaching is focused on introductory level economics. I teach a range of students, including first year undergraduates, postgraduates and graduate apprentices. I also lead the economics courses on the MBA programme. My general approach to teaching is to emphasise how economic theory can be applied to real world examples.

I am currently working towards Fellowship of the Higher Education Authority, and I completed the Aurora (Women in Leadership) Programme in April 2023. I am the Year 3 Coordinator for EBS Graduate Apprenticeship Programmes. I also am a member of working groups looking into programme development.

Background

Prior to working at Heriot-Watt, I did some teaching for Borders College. Before that, I took time out to raise my two daughters and prior to that I ran my own small business. I started my academic teaching at the University of Reading whilst undertaking my PhD there.
